Q- Blood proteins are incapable of blood clotting inside the blood vessels but from the blood clot at the injury. How is it possible?

Answer- We all know that blood proteins are incapable of blood clotting inside the blood vessels. Still the blood get clotted when any injury takes place in blood vessels that is because of the presence of blood platelets in the blood that forms a net like structure at the part where injury takes place and this net clots the blood and prevent the flow of blood out of the body. In this way blood platelets are responsible for blood clotting in the body.
